“…11 Recently, heterostructures of onedimensional nanowires integrated with extraneous nanoparticles were demonstrated to be of great interest due to their excellent detection sensitivity, reproducibility, stability, and biocompatibility. 12,13 Silicon (Si) nanowires have been utilized in bioelectronics, nanoelectronics, optical devices, and energy devices. [14][15][16] The pristine Si nanowires only exhibit moderate Raman sensitivity for molecular detection, and thus proper surface modication or heterostructuring of the nanowires are of particular interest for the purpose of SERS sensing.…”
